深度学习 | 【01】初步介绍

一、深度学习介绍

1、概念

机器学习的一个分支,是一种以人工神经网络为架构,对数据进行特征学习的算法。

2、机器学习与深度学习的区别
2.1 特征提取

在这里插入图片描述

  • 机器学习需要有人工的特征提取过程;
  • 深度学习可以通过深度神经网络自动完成
2.2 数据量

在这里插入图片描述

  • 深度学习需要大量的训练数据,会有更高的效果;
  • 深度学习训练深度神经网络需要大量的算力,因为其中有更多的参数。
3、应用场景

在这里插入图片描述

4、常见深度学习框架

TensorFlowCaffe2KerasTheanoPyTorchChainerDyNetMXNetCNTK

神经网络介绍

1、人工神经网络概念

人工神经网络(ANN):神经网络(NN)或类神经网络,是一种模仿生物神经网络(动物的中枢神经系统,特别是大脑)的结构和功能的数学模型,用于对函数进行估计或近似

2、神经元概念
  • 在生物神经网络中,每个神经元与其他神经元相连,当它兴奋时,就会向相连的神经元发送化学物质,从而改变这些神经元内的电位;如果某神经元的电位超过了一个阈值,那么它就会被激活,即“兴奋"起来,向其他神经元发送化学物质。
  • 1943年,McCulloch和Pitts将上述情形抽象为上图所示的简单模型,这就是一直沿用至今的M-P神经元模型。把许多这样的神经元按一定的层次结构连接起来,就得到了神经网络。

在这里插入图片描述

  • a1,a2……an为各个输入的分量;
  • w1,w2……wn各个输入分量对应的权重参数;
  • b为偏置;
  • f为激活函数【tangsigmoidrelu】;
  • t为神经元的输出;
  • 公式为:t = f(W^T * A + B)
  • 一个神经元的功能是求得输入向量权向量的内积后,经一个非线性传递函数得到一个标量的结果。
3、单层神经网络

最基本的神经元网络形式,由有限个神经元构成,所有神经元的输入向量都是同一个向量。由于每一个神经元都会产生一个标量结果,所以单层神经元的输出是一个向量,向量的维数等于神经元的数目。单层作为了解,不常见。

在这里插入图片描述

4、感知机

感知机由两层神经网络组成,输入层接收外界输入信号后传递给输出层·(输出+1正例,-1反例)·,输出层是M-P神经元

在这里插入图片描述

w0……wn为权重。

作用:
  • 把一个n维向呈空问用一个超平面分割成两部分,给定一个输入向量,超平面可以判断出这个向量位于超平面的哪一边,得到输入时正类或者是反类,对应到2维空间就是一条直线把一个平面分为两个部分。
  • 简单的二分类
5、多层神经网络

多层神经网络就是由单层神经网络进行叠加之后得到的,所以就形成了层的概念,常见的多层神经网络有如下结构:

  • 输入层(Input layer),众多神经元(Neuron)接受大呈非线形输入消息。输入的消息称为输入向量。【特征值】
  • 输出层(Output layer),消息在神经元链接中传输、分析、权衡,形成输出结果。输出的消息称为输出向量。【目标值】
    -隐藏层(Hidden layer),简称隐层"”,是输入层和输出层之间众多神经元和链接组成的各个层面。隐层可以有一层或多层。隐层的节点(神经元)数目不定,但数目越多神经网络的非线性越显著,从而神经网络的强健性(robustness)更显著。

在这里插入图片描述

5.1 全连接层

当前一层和一层每个神经元互相链接。

6、激活函数

在对于分类问题,不能用过线性来准确分类是,我们可以通过感知机模型来更好的分类。即使用多层神经网络,在前面的感知机模型在增加一层。

>

增加后

在这里插入图片描述

但经过对公式进行化简后仍然为一个线性模型。因此,这个模型并没有得到改善。此时,提出了在感知机的基础上加上非线性的激活函数之后,输出的结果就不是线性模型。进而

6.1 作用
  • 可见,激活函数是增加模型的非线性分割能力
  • 此外,可以提高模型的鲁棒性【健壮和强壮】;
  • 缓解梯度消失问题;
  • 加速模型收敛。
6.2 常见激活函数

在这里插入图片描述

  • sigmoid:只会输出整数以及靠近0的输出变化率最大;
  • tanh:与sigmoid类似,但是tanh输出是可以为负数;
  • Relu:输入只能大于0。常用于对图片格式的处理

  • 2
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 1
    评论
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

Jxiepc

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值